You don't need to. You'll need to fix shitty buggy code written by business folks who were "empowered" by AI.

I do it now in my current work. Management encouraged their business folks to learn to code via bootcamp, gave them access to copilot etc. they believe they can lay off their IT with the scheme. While our original work should be just to deploy their shit, the code is incredibly buggy, that we have to fix them, spend more time on them compared to just doing it the non-AI assisted way of development.
